- [ ] Step 7: Archive cold storage buckets (Glacierline tier). Confirm both ceremony witnesses are present, verify bucket manifests match the Oxbow ledger, then seal the archive key shares. Plugin authors may observe but not handle shares. Once sealed, the archive index itself is encrypted and can only be reopened with the passphrase below.

vault phrase of badup-hahig = tamael-aldael-kelmir-istael-fenok-istwyn-tamius-jorath-oliion

This page documents the quotas applied during the Glimmerpane color-contrast audit pipeline. Each release candidate build is scanned screen-by-screen, and findings are capped per component family to keep report volume manageable for triage. Exceeding a quota does not block the release train automatically, but it does flag the build for manual review by the Tidehollow accessibility group. Before adjusting any cap, please confirm the downstream dashboards can absorb the change. The current thresholds are listed below.

tuning constants:
QUOTAS = {
    "druwyn": 5,
    "holix": 5,
    "zorath": 5,
    "holwyn": 10,
}

This alert fires when more than 2% of requests entering the Lumenary edge gateway lose trace context before reaching downstream microservices. For the security reviewer: broken propagation degrades our ability to reconstruct request paths during incident forensics, so sustained gaps are treated as an audit-integrity risk, not just an observability bug. Typical causes are header-stripping proxies or stale SDK versions. Triage steps, affected service matrix, and escalation criteria are maintained on the internal page referenced below.

runbook for badug-kadup: https://confluence.zemvarlabs.internal/projects/browse/display/projects/bd1b